Trouver la meilleure API de carte pour les applications mobiles géolocalisées
Publié: 2021-07-02De la recherche d'itinéraires sur Google Maps à l'appel d'un taxi via Uber, les applications de géolocalisation sont devenues une colonne vertébrale pour de nombreux groupes prospères. Divers services de localisation sont devenus un voisinage logique de multiples applications. On profite d'une fonctionnalité GPS automatiquement, sans réfléchir : lors de la commande d'un taxi, lors d'un déplacement, lors de la recherche d'un quartier où se restaurer, etc. Les entreprises considèrent également la géolocalisation comme un plus : entre autres, une organisation peut envoyer des notifications à utilisateurs qui se trouvent à proximité immédiate de leur magasin, restaurant, etc. Pour mettre dans toutes les API ci-dessus pour les services basés principalement sur la zone sont nécessaires.
Pourquoi utiliser des solutions géolocalisées et cartographiques ?
De nos jours, il n'est pas facile d'imaginer ce que les êtres humains faisaient avec les cartes papier. Heureusement, cette époque est peut-être révolue et nous avons maintenant à notre disposition des appareils de navigation GPS et des applications mobiles.
La tâche de la fonction GPS est de détecter l'emplacement actuel de l'appareil et de mettre à jour les connaissances car elles changent. Ensuite, nous utiliserons ces données à notre guise.
Les informations du monde réel et l'intelligence du site vous aident à prendre de meilleures décisions commerciales. L'intelligence de localisation permet aux entreprises de vérifier les données, de comprendre le contexte et d'analyser et de développer des informations.
Avec des données visualisées, vous déterminerez les raisons de vous connecter et d'interagir avec les clients pour offrir une expérience transparente unique à vos utilisateurs finaux. Les services basés sur la localisation aident les entreprises à :
- Construire de meilleures expériences client
- Optimiser les opérations de l'entreprise
- Favorisez les décisions stratégiques en connectant des informations que les clients ne pouvaient pas voir auparavant
- Les services basés sur la localisation utilisent les données géographiques en temps réel d'un smartphone pour fournir des informations, des divertissements ou la sécurité.
- De l'affichage des prévisions météorologiques à la recommandation de restaurants près de chez vous, les services basés sur la localisation offrent des commodités à plusieurs personnes par jour.
Il existe de nombreuses fonctions que les clients ignorent ou en se désinscrivant des offres basées sur le lieu. Les services basés sur la localisation ne sont pas presque des cartes et des voyages ; dans certains cas, ils contribuent à la sécurité et à la sûreté en cas de criminalité et de catastrophes naturelles.
Les services basés sur la localisation sont essentiels pour diverses raisons. Par exemple, ils indiquent à un chauffeur Uber votre position pour vous trouver et venir vous chercher. Ou, une société avec plusieurs emplacements peut suggérer des promotions dans le magasin le plus proche de chez vous. Si une application climatique connaît votre région, elle peut vous montrer la météo à votre place.
Qu'est-ce que l'API Map ?
Une API de carte (également appelée API de cartographie) fournit des informations de localisation aux développeurs de logiciels créant des produits et services basés sur la localisation. Il s'agit d'un élément de base pour les applications de localisation, les cartes riches en fonctionnalités et ainsi la récupération de données géographiques. Il vous permet de créer des infographies, des cartes mentales et des aides à la visualisation tenant compte de la localisation.
Une API de carte typique comprend des fonctionnalités pour le géocodage, le géocodage inversé, la géolocalisation, les directions et la navigation, l'interaction avec l'écran tactile, différents types de cartes (par exemple, terrain ou satellite) et des objets de contrôle personnalisables.
Plans
Les constructeurs peuvent personnaliser les cartes avec des faits contextuels et applicables à l'industrie superposés à l'utilisation de widgets, d'appareils, de marqueurs, d'images, de photos et de fenêtres contextuelles. Les cartes sont des options interactives et informatives pour le contenu textuel. Ils fournissent un outil facile à utiliser et rentable pour l'image de marque et l'engagement client des petites entreprises.
Données
Les constructeurs de logiciels utilisent des APIS cartographiques pour récupérer des informations sur les lieux, par exemple des informations de proximité sur les emplacements, les distances et les périodes de trajet entre les points de terminaison, les enregistrements de lieux et les tendances des clients principalement basées sur la région, à appliquer dans des applications sur mesure.
Statistiques
Les chercheurs utilisent des API cartographiques pour identifier les anomalies des conditions météorologiques, suivre les épidémies dans les programmes de gestion de la santé, tracer des grilles de gestion des catastrophes et déterminer les modes d'achat des clients.
Pourquoi l'API Google Map est-elle celle-là ?
L'API Maps JavaScript et quelques codes Python vous permettent de personnaliser les cartes collectivement avec votre contenu et vos images pour les afficher sur des sites Web et des gadgets mobiles. L'API Maps JavaScript et les codes Python comportent quatre types de cartes de base (feuille de route, satellite, hybride et terrain). Vous effectuerez des modifications à l'aide de calques et de styles, de commandes et d'événements, ainsi que de divers services et bibliothèques.
Facteurs importants à prendre en compte lors du choix de votre API de carte
Lors du choix d'une solution pour gérer vos API, vérifiez leur facilité d'utilisation, leur facilité de gestion, leur gouvernance, leur sécurité et l'étendue de leurs fonctionnalités.
Un certain nombre d'utilisateurs d'applications
Au cours de ce mois, 154,4 millions d'utilisateurs ont accédé à l'application Google Maps, ce qui en fait loin d'être le seul service populaire sur ce segment.
Prix
Google Maps Platform offre un crédit mensuel gratuit de 200 $ pour les cartes, les itinéraires et les lieux (voir Crédits de compte de facturation).
Facilité d'utilisation
Lors de la recherche d'un outil de gestion des API, la facilité d'utilisation doit être un facteur important, en particulier dans un environnement d'entreprise où plusieurs API peuvent avoir besoin d'être contrôlées et gérées. Il peut être utile d'évaluer à quel point il est facile de lancer et d'exécuter la solution. Quelle que soit sa méthode de déploiement, comme le cloud ou sur site, vous devez confirmer que l'outil que vous avez choisi est simple à aligner.
Alternative à l'API Google Map
Boîte de carte
Si quelqu'un reconnaît une opportunité une fois qu'il la voit, c'est l'équipe de Map box. Dès que la nouvelle de l'API Google Maps a éclaté, le PDG de Map Box, Eric Gunderson, a appelé les développeurs à prendre le train en marche. D'ici le 11 juin, tout développeur novice sur Mapbox peut s'inscrire et utiliser gratuitement toutes les API de paiement à l'utilisation. Vous n'avez même pas besoin d'ajouter une MasterCard pour commencer. Tweetez simplement #WeAreBuilders sur Mapbox avec un lien vers votre carte.
Cartes Sygic
Sygic est une plate-forme agnostique de niveau entreprise qui propose des cartes basées sur le cloud de HERE, TomTom, OSM, et al. . Bien que leurs tarifs ne soient pas disponibles en ligne, ils nous assurent qu'ils sont assez abordables et très transparents, et les ont aidés à rassembler 200 millions d'utilisateurs au cours des 15 dernières années.
ArcGIS
Un ensemble d'applications intégrées basées sur la localisation, qui s'utilisent où que vous soyez. Sur votre ordinateur portable, votre appareil mobile ou votre navigateur, démarrez vos workflows avec la collection d'applications intégrées d'ArcGIS Apps, basées principalement sur le lieu, capables de fonctionner, où que vous soyez.
EmplacementIQ
Si votre projet nécessite un géocodage ou un géocodage inversé, LocationIQ peut être une alternative honnête. Sa version tarifaire exceptionnellement bas prix vous offre 10 000 transactions en vrac cohérentes par jour pour une utilisation non professionnelle, en même temps que pour les clients commerciaux, le plan le plus vendu est celui de 50 000 appels selon aujourd'hui pour une centaine de dollars. Les faits de LocationIQ sont alimentés via OpenStreetMap.
Plateforme de temps de trajet
Période La plate-forme permet à n'importe quel site Internet ou application mobile avec un contenu spécifique à l'emplacement (propriété, emplois, petites annonces, annuaires, rencontres, bons, détaillants, et bien plus encore). La recherche par période double généralement le nombre de résultats pertinents. La plate-forme de période est exclusive, commercialement disponible dans tout le Royaume-Uni et a été testée avec succès dans la plupart des grands pays européens (et au-delà). Journey Time apporte la valeur financière, sociale et environnementale des statistiques GNSS aux clients de tous les sites Web qui les référencent. La plate-forme n'est pas seulement une application simple ; c'est à des kilomètres une réponse d'arrêt pour arrêter. Il alimente également plusieurs équipements d'évaluation commerciale différents qui permettent à nos clients d'examiner facilement leurs propres informations en quelques mots. Ceci est particulièrement utile dans le secteur de la logistique.
Conclusion
La première étape à franchir avant de se lancer dans le développement d'applications mobiles basées sur la localisation est de vous renseigner et une fois que vous en êtes absolument sûr, engagez un développeur d'applications mobiles. Cela vous guidera tout au long du processus de développement et vous donnera le meilleur résultat. La qualité de l'application doit être de premier ordre, c'est le seul domaine dans lequel vous ne pouvez pas faire de compromis, même si vous envisagez de lancer une application mobile basée sur la localisation. La demande pour ces API de carte a augmenté et les perspectives d'avenir des applications mobiles basées sur la localisation sont meilleures dans les années à venir, comme le montrent les rapports de certaines des recherches les plus remarquables.
Avec l'aide des services de développement python et d'une équipe de développement d'applications expérimentée, vous pouvez créer votre propre API de carte pour les applications mobiles basées sur la localisation. Emizentech est une société leader dans le développement d'applications qui peut vous aider à développer des applications mobiles innovantes. Donc, si vous avez une idée d'application, contactez-nous.